Small Loader Land Clearing : Boosting Output & Helpful Advice
Employing a compact tractor for land clearing drastically improves the work compared to hand methods. These flexible machines excel at managing thick undergrowth , shrubs and rocks , making them perfect for commercial undertakings . To maximize your land clearing effort , consider these points :
- Carefully assess the terrain and identify any underground utilities .
- Select the appropriate attachment – a mulcher is typically best for heavy brush , while a grapple is useful for removing substantial material.
- Regularly check your blade for imperfections and conduct necessary maintenance .
- Focus on safety by donning appropriate safety gear and following safety protocols.
Remember, efficient brush removal with a skid steer requires planning and a emphasis on both speed and preservation.
Small Excavator Land Removal : When to Choose For It
When assessing land site preparation options, a mini excavator can be a smart choice. Compared to larger machinery, these versatile units shine in situations with tight access. Imagine working around established homes or in areas with difficult terrain – a mini excavator can often navigate where a bulldozer or large tractor cannot . Moreover , they’re often more cost-effective for smaller jobs , minimizing both the initial expense and the potential for harm to existing greenery . Here are a few key scenarios where a small excavator excels :
- Working in areas with confined space.
- Careful clearing around delicate planting .
- Minor jobs like driveway creation.
- Scenarios requiring detailed digging or excavation .
In conclusion, a small excavator offers a balanced solution for property preparation when size and accuracy are paramount.
How Much Does Land Clearing Really Cost?
Figuring out the exact expense of land preparation can be quite tricky . Several elements brushworks land clearing determine the overall amount . Generally, you can reckon on paying anywhere from $300 to $7,500 per hectare , but that an ballpark. This price varies significantly depending on a extent of the area, the density of vegetation present – including shrubs , boulders, and roots – and the processes needed for the job . For instance , significant wood removal can cost more than simply clearing scrub .
Preparing Land with a Compact Loader: A Step-by-Step Method
Clearing vegetation and undergrowth from a area of land with a skid steer can be a straightforward undertaking when approached carefully. First, evaluate the terrain to identify any potential hazards, like buried utilities or large rocks. Next, commence with clearing the densest areas using a mulching head attachment – remember to move in short, overlapping sweeps. Then, use a bucket attachment to gather the removed plant life into manageable piles for hauling. Finally, grade the ground to the intended elevation, ensuring you remove any remaining small debris. Always emphasize safety by using appropriate personal protective equipment and checking the work area frequently for variations.
Assessing Techniques: Loader vs. Small Digger for Land Clearing
When tackling site preparation tasks, determining the best equipment is essential. While a loader and a compact excavator can execute the job, they present distinct upsides. Loaders generally are superior at handling substantial amounts of waste and grading surfaces, while mini excavators are more effective when confronting heavy vegetation, roots, and rough surfaces. Finally, the ideal choice copyrights on the unique obstacles of the area and the complete scope of the preparation required.
